Overcoming Self-Doubt: Identifying and Addressing Triggers

Self-doubt can undermine our confidence and hinder personal growth. By understanding the triggers that contribute to self-doubt, we can take proactive steps to overcome it. Here are four common triggers that hold us back and strategies to address them:
- Past experiences: Negative past experiences, failures, and setbacks can fuel self-doubt. It’s vital to recognize that these experiences don’t define our capabilities or potential for success. Instead, we should focus on learning from them and using them as stepping stones for growth.
- Negative self-talk: The internal dialogue we engage in plays a significant role in self-doubt. Negative self-talk perpetuates doubt and self-criticism. To counteract this, we need to reframe our self-talk and replace it with a positive narrative. By practicing self-compassion and cultivating a growth mindset, we can silence the inner critic.
- Fear responses: Fear of failure and fear of success often trigger self-doubt. Stepping outside of our comfort zone can activate these fears. However, it’s important to recognize that growth occurs beyond our comfort zone. Embracing discomfort and reframing fear as an opportunity for learning and development can help us overcome self-doubt.
- Imposter syndrome: Imposter syndrome is the fear of being perceived as a fraud or feeling undeserving of accomplishments. It’s crucial to understand that many individuals experience this syndrome, and we aren’t alone in our doubts. By acknowledging imposter syndrome and reframing it as a sign of competence and ambition, we can dismantle self-doubt.
Strategies for Overcoming Self-Doubt and Unlocking Your Full Potential

To conquer self-doubt, it’s crucial to employ effective strategies that empower us to believe in ourselves and achieve our utmost capabilities. Recognizing the detrimental impact of self-doubt and understanding its triggers is the first step towards overcoming it.
Here are some powerful strategies to help you overcome self-doubt:
- Challenge and Replace Negative Thoughts: Combat self-doubt by actively challenging negative thoughts and replacing them with positive affirmations. This cognitive restructuring technique nurtures a more optimistic mindset and bolsters self-belief.
- Surround Yourself with Supportive and Uplifting Individuals: Creating a network of supportive and uplifting people is essential in combating self-doubt. Engaging with individuals who believe in us and our abilities can provide the encouragement and validation we need to overcome self-doubt.
- Gradually Step Outside Your Comfort Zone: To enhance confidence, it’s beneficial to take small but consistent steps outside of your comfort zone. By gradually pushing the boundaries of what feels safe, you can build resilience and expand your capabilities.
- Celebrate Successes and Focus on Strengths: Acknowledge and celebrate your achievements, no matter how small. By directing your attention towards your strengths and accomplishments, you can boost self-confidence and diminish self-doubt.

What Are Some Common Signs of Self-Doubt in the Workplace?
In the workplace, signs of self-doubt can include seeking constant reassurance, feeling inadequate, and struggling to accept compliments. Recognizing these signs is important for overcoming self-doubt and unlocking our full potential.
